Being addicted to something that is given to you to "help" in the first place is a bit different, just a bit, than being addicted to something you started on your own. Listening to his admission, he still had quite a bit of pain like he did when FIRST given the medication. That should have been flag #1 for the prescribing Dr. Also, the Dr SHOULD have realized that he needed to get him onto another painkiller rather than leave him on the same one for so long. I don't see Rush recovering in the 30 days he is giving himself because of how long he was one that one medication. It rewires your brain, and that's not something that many years worth of taking can be reversed in 30 days IMHO.

He wasn't taking the pills as a way to curb pain towards the end, don't let his little speech lead you to believe that.

The amount of pills he was acquiring was so excessive, it's a minimum of 10 times that of the perscribed usage.

He never stated that he acquired the drugs illegally even though he did.

Oxycontin is a time-released pain killer. It works extremely well at curbing pain for ~12 hours. However, it needs to be swallowed. Apparently, he was crushing them before taking. You might as well snort heroin if you take the drug that way.
